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son is miscast as John Matthews, a truck-driving father who tries to get his son out of prison by becoming an undercover informant. Johnson is a hulk of a man who looks like he could tear the head off just about anyone. John, on the other hand, doesn’t know a thing about the world of drugs and guns. He lives in the suburbs with his family and gets more than he bargained for when he tries to take down the local cartel. Much like Breaking Bad’s Walter White, John Matthews is an underdog that you can’t help but root for, even as he finds himself in the middle of some incredible jams. But Johnson is such a limited actor, he can’t carry the film, and the supporting cast doesn’t do any better (Sarandon in particular really phones it in).
